MUMA presents 'Flor del jardín 03 (XL)', an original 2026 acrylic painting on canvas (100 × 80 cm) in multicolour with orange, blue, yellow and cream, in the metafysical art style depicting nature, signed by hand with a certificate of authenticity, shipped rolled in a tube directly from the artists.

"Flor de jardín 03" is organized as a minimal architecture that evokes the idea of access or transit. The large orange arch, open and bold, functions as a symbolic door that frames a blue vertical axis, establishing a tension between interior and exterior, between what is contained and what passes through. At the top, the fragmented semicircular form suggests a suspended sun or an incomplete vault, reinforcing the notion of boundary and passage.
The use of color intensifies this reading: the orange, warm and expansive, contrasts with the central blue, denser and deeper, generating a contrast that is not only chromatic but also spatial. The dark base anchors the structure, giving it weight and stability, while the neutral background eliminates any contextual reference, placing the scene in a mental, almost metaphysical space.
The work can be understood as a metaphor for the threshold: an intermediate place where something begins or ends. There is no explicit narrative, but there is a sense of contained transit, of energy held in the moment before crossing. In its formal economy, the piece builds a clear, quiet language, where geometry becomes perceptual experience.
About MUMA:
MUMA is an artistic duo formed by a Generalist 3D and Designer and an Art Historian, both educated at Universidad CEU San Pablo in Madrid. Their artistic practice centers on the visual arts, with particular interest in color, movement, and the dynamism of forms, as well as environmental variations. Their work is conceived to integrate into space and establish a direct dialogue with routine and human experience, exploring a vital vision linked to impressionist ideals, such as the relationship with nature, color, and changing environments. MUMA is connected to the professional world of digital and visual arts in Madrid, with participations in competitions.
